Viewpoint Reports#
Opening the Reports Module#
The Reports module can be launched from both the Review and Processing applications. The user should have the Access Reports permission to use the Reports module and as well as the Customize Reports permission to make changes to the reports.
- Processing: Select the Reports button from the Project tab.
- Review: Select the Reports button from the Tools section of the main Review window, as shown in the following screen:

Report Settings#

The Report Settings section allows the user to change the look and feel of generated reports. This section is also used to change the behavior of the filter settings.
Appearance Settings#

The look and feel of a report can be altered for each Company listed within the Viewpoint. The Appearance Settings button is only active, if the user has been granted the Customize Reports permission in the Security Management module.
- To use this tool, the user selects which company’s report template to be customized from the left side.
- Click the section in the template pane to highlight the section. It will populate the middle pane with the settings that can be altered.
- To change the logo in the report template, click the Logo field in the middle pane and browse to the file location of the new logo file.
- It is recommended to use a square .png file with a dimension of at least 60X60 and a transparent background.
- The size of the logo will be scaled automatically to fit the space predefined for the logo.
Configuration Settings#

- This button is only active if the user has been granted the Customize Reports permission in the Security Management module.
- The Configuration Settings button allows the user to edit the name and description of the various reports.
- The user can simply click the field and change the existing text.
- Clicking OK to save the changes.
- These changes will be reflected in the report name in the Report Filter panel and in the report name and description values in the generated reports.

Chart Type#
There are nine chart types to choose from the available list to represent the data. Hovering over the chart type will display the chart name. When you select a different chart type, it will immediately update the chart without having to regenerate the report.
Reset, Legend, Labels, Single Series, and Title#
The Reset button will revert the chart back to the original zoom, legend selection, and chart filters. The Legend and Labels buttons will toggle on/off the chart legend and data labels. The Title option allows the user to change the title at the top of the chart or hide it completely.
The Single Series button toggles on/off how the right-click Review option behaves in the Chart panel. There are some charts that can have multiple categories for each Value displayed in the chart.
For example, chart for the File Extensions report can show the number of cataloged files, extracted files, and the files after dedupe for each file extension listed on the graph. With Single Series turned off, right-click Review will display the results for all the categories of the file extension lumped together. With Single Series turned on, right-click Review will display only the results for the individual selected category for the file extension in the graph.
The Selection Color button provides the ability to change the color of a graph category when you click on. Using ctrl+click to select multiple categories will turn the color of the selected categories to the color chosen in this setting. This is meant to avoid confusion of which categories are selected when a category in the graph has the same color as the default selection color.
Print / Export#

Print Preview gives the option to preview either the report or the chart.
Print gives the option to print either the report or the chart. Selecting either one will open the printer settings where the user can select a printer.
Export allows the user to export out the report into Microsoft Excel (with or without the header), PDF, or Word formats. Alternatively, the Chart Data (Grid option) will export either all rows or only checked rows of the Chart Data panel to Excel.
Reports / Filters Panel#
This is the left-most panel, by default. The reports are separated into several categories. When a category is selected, the list of reports are displayed in the upper portion of the panel. A list of available filters are displayed in the bottom section of the panel for the report selected. A complete list of the reports available in the Processing and Review applications are available at the end of this manual.
For users with the Securable Lookup permission, right-click on a report in the panel will give the option to view the Security Access to the report. Security Access is a quick way to see which users have permissions to view and/or customize the report.
Reports Panel#
This is the main panel in the window. The panel will remain blank until a report is generated. There are a few right-click options that give the user the ability to print, export, zoom, or change the page setup.
Users can also sort columns of generated reports prior to exporting by clicking the Sort icon located on the right side of each column header.
Chart Panel#

This panel can be toggled on/off by clicking the Chart button on the Ribbon menu. Once a report has been generated, the chart will display in this panel. Right-click in the panel will give the option to review the selected section of the chart. If this is done in the Processing Reports module, a search results grid will open in the Process tab displaying the records of the selected section of the chart.
In the Review Reports module, choosing the Review option will create a View in the Adhoc folder. Also, in the Review Reports, there is an option to create a View from the chart. This will open a new window where the user can name the View and decide which folder to build it in.
To build a View or review multiple categories of a graph, ctrl+click to select the desired categories and then right-click to select either Review or Create View. Right-click on the chart to copy the chart to the clipboard, as well as to filter the Chart Data panel to the chart value selected.
Note: Refer to the section in this manual that covers the Single Series button, as this may have an effect on the number of files that are displayed in the results for graph values with multiple categories when using the Review or Build View right-click options.
Chart Data Panel#
The Chart Data panel lists the data that is used to generate the chart. All the available field values for the chart will be listed. Checking/unchecking records in this panel will instantly add/remove the record from the chart. The chart data can be exported to Excel using the right-click option.
